Spring is on its way to Vermillion County, and with it comes our newest tradition: the March Makerโs Market at the CRC (301 Blackman St, Clinton, 47842). This isnโt just another eventโitโs a chance for neighbors to connect, for local artisans to shine, and for all of us to support the small businesses that make our community special. Behind it all is Brittany Page, whose passion for bringing people together has turned this market into something truly meaningful.
In our conversation, Brittany shares the story behind the market, why the CRC is the perfect place to host it, and how events like this strengthen our local economy and keep our small-town spirit alive. Sheโll also tell you what to expect on March 14th from 1-4 PM, why itโs a must-visit for families and shoppers alike, and how she dreams of growing it even bigger in the future.
So, take a moment to read on and then mark your calendarsโbecause this is one event you wonโt want to miss.
Interview with Brittany Page
Conducted by Tom Burkett for the Vermillion County Chamber of Commerce
๐ง๐ผ๐บ ๐๐๐ฟ๐ธ๐ฒ๐๐:
"Brittany, thank you so much for taking the time to chat with me today. I know how busy you must be getting ready for the March Makerโs Market. To start, what was the spark that led you to create this event? Was it something you saw missing in Vermillion County, or just a love of bringing folks together?"
๐๐ฟ๐ถ๐๐๐ฎ๐ป๐ ๐ฃ๐ฎ๐ด๐ฒ:
"First, I would like to say thank you, Tom, for reaching out for an interview to share with the Chamber of Commerce. Itโs nice to virtually meet you! I appreciate anyone who is willing to help small businesses grow and support community events. I have a heart for bringing people together and encouraging members of the community and surrounding areas to get out more to see what events the area has to offer!"
๐ง๐ผ๐บ:
"The CRC feels like the heart of Clinton sometimes. What made it the perfect spot for this market? Was it the space, the location, or just that itโs where the community already gathers?"
๐๐ฟ๐ถ๐๐๐ฎ๐ป๐:
"I decided to reach out to many different places to host this type of event, and thankfully, the owner of CRC, Brian, communicated with me and agreed. Now, the March Makerโs Market (March 14th, 1-4 PM) has been formed! Iโm thankful he has been accommodating and open to having this event for the benefit of small businesses and citizens in the Wabash Valley!"
๐ง๐ผ๐บ:
"How do you think this market benefits Vermillion County? Is it about supporting small businesses, or is there something even biggerโlike keeping that small-town connection alive?"
๐๐ฟ๐ถ๐๐๐ฎ๐ป๐:
"This market supports Vermillion County by encouraging residents to shop local, which strengthens the local economy. Events like this also create much bigger shared experiences and keep that small-town spirit alive!"
๐ง๐ผ๐บ:
"Letโs get down to brass tacks: The market is on March 30th, right? What time should folks show up to get the best picks?"
๐๐ฟ๐ถ๐๐๐ฎ๐ป๐:
"The March Makerโs Market is actually on Saturday, March 14th, from 1-4 PM. Doors open to the community at CRC at 1 PM!"
๐ง๐ผ๐บ:
"What kind of vendors can we expect this year? Any new faces or old favorites people should keep an eye out for?"
๐๐ฟ๐ถ๐๐๐ฎ๐ป๐:
"Visitors can expect 20+ local vendors offering a wide variety of handmade and specialty items, including candles, wax melts, jewelry, driftwood home decor, boutique clothing, custom shirts made on-site, leather goods, kitchenware and pantry items, wreaths and table centerpieces, handcrafted face and body care products, 3D prints and laser-engraved wood items, light-up coozies and buckets, a delicious assortment of baked goods, canned items, desserts, hand-crocheted toys, and even a local professional face painter! There will truly be something for everyone!"
